4. 7 2 8 AUTO TARE active AUTO TARE inactive Auto tare activation serves to stabilize the zero point of the balance Minor changes in weight in the zero point range are tared automatically i e the displayed figure remains at zero 7 2 9 FILTER SPEED The balance can be adapted in stages to its location from 1 5 Stage 1 good installation conditions fast display low filter effect e g proportioning Stage 5 poor installation conditions slow display high filter effect restless environment e g proportion weighing requires a greater display speed and this can be adjusted by selecting Fast in the MODE program 7 2 10 AUTO OFF active AUTO OFF inactive The auto off function inactivates the balance after approx 60 seconds if it is not in use 7 2 11 VARIABLE FACTOR The weighing value in grams is automatically multiplied by the set variable factor and the result including the unit shown on the display Example A sheet of paper sized 10 x 10cm weighs 0 6 g In order to determine the weight g im the factor has to be at 100 The display value is 0 6g x 100 60 0 thus 60 0 g m 7 2 12 PRESELECT UNIT UNIT select All selected units checked YES in Preselect Units are offered on the UNIT key in weighing mode for unit changeover Recommendation Only preselect the units that are actually required Each time the UNIT key is pressed the next preselected unit using Preselect Units is selected cA qw

13. zero point 0 9 Blank or weighing value with unit depending on the load on the weighing plate CR Carriage Return LF Line Feed With Enumerator Bit Nr 1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 NN N B B B B B B B B 0 0 B G B B CR LF N Enumerator 572 573 KB DS FKB FCB BA e 1058 35 7 5 3 Numerator The Numerator is found under the menu point Printer and can be activated and deactivated When editing data with the use of the print option the range of the numerator will increase by one place 7 6 Printer With the serial data output RS 232 a printer can be connected The printout shows the weight in grams When the counting mode is selected the number of pieces or the weight is printed When the percent mode is selected the percentage or the weight will be printed Press The PRINT key to print weighing results Select the enumerator to number the weighing continuously Turn off the balance or use the CLEAR function to Reset the enumerator to 000 7 7 Underfloor weighing Objects which because of their size or shape cannot be put on the scale can be weighed by means of underfloor weighing Proceed as follows Switch off the balance Turn the balance over without loading the balance plate Open the cover plate on the base of the balance Hang on the hook for underfloor weighing Place the balance over an opening Hang the item to be weighed on the hook and carry out we

26. lance in verification operation indication of range 27 7 2 Operation 7 2 1 WEIGHING with TARE During weighing in a certain weight amount of a product is to be filled into a weighing container with out the tare weight of the container being weighed The weighing container is excluded from considera tion by using TARE and thus only the measured value of the product is indicated The maximum weighing range is reduced by the value of the tare weighing container tare is therefore classed as being subtractive Wait until the g or kg unit symbol appears on the display The weighing result is now stable 7 2 2 COUNT Selection reference piece In order to be able to count a larger quantity of parts it is necessary to determine Ihe average weight of each part using a small quantity reference piece number The greater the reference piece number the greater the counting accuracy In the case of small or very varied parts a particularly high reference piece number must be selected COUNT Commence by applying the number of parts of the determined reference piece number Using the automatic reference optimization OPT the counting accuracy is automatically increased when applying up to 100 items Now apply the quantity to be counted 7 2 3 PERCENT When using percentage weighing it is possible to remove partial amounts from the weighing container Instead of the manual withdrawal there can also for example the evaporated amount of mois

36. wing at the place of installation Place the balance on a firm level surface Avoid extreme heat as well as temperature fluctuation caused by installing next to a radiator or in the direct sunlight Protect the balance against direct draughts due to open windows and doors Avoid jarring during weighing Protect the balance against high humidity vapours and dust Do not expose the device to extreme dampness for longer periods of time Inadmissible bedewing condensation of air moisture on the device can occur if a cold device is taken into a significantly warmer environment In this case please acclimatise the device for approx 2 hours at room tem perature after it has been disconnected from the mains Avoid static charging of the material to be weighed weighing container and windshield Major display deviations incorrect weighing results are possible if electromagnetic fields occur as well as due to static charging and instable power supply It is then necessary to change the location 572 573 KB DS FKB FCB BA e 1058 23 6 2 Unpacking Carefully remove the balance from its packaging remove the plastic wrapping and position the balance in its intended working location 6 2 1 Installation Install the balance in such a fashion that the weighing plate is absolutely horizontally 6 3 Mains supply Electric power supply is by means of the external mains supply circuit The printed voltage level must comply with the
